Sidewalk and Lane Closure at Laird Station Friday August 7, 2020
What Work Is Taking Place?
On Friday August 7, 2020, crews will perform a concrete pour at the Laird Station Main Entrance site. The work will be performed using a mobile crane and several concrete trucks. The eastbound curb lane on Eglinton Avenue East, the south sidewalk in front of Laird Station Main Entrance as well as the west and south crosswalks at Laird Drive and Eglinton Avenue East will be closed while this work takes place. Upon completion of the pour, the lane, sidewalk and crosswalks will re-open. Read more »
